The region is a haven for outdoor enthusiasts. The Mallacoota Inlet, a vast body of water fed by the Genoa and Wallagaraugh rivers, is renowned for its fishing, particularly for bream and flathead. Beyond the water, the surrounding national park offers an extensive network of walking tracks, from easy lakeside strolls to more challenging hikes with stunning coastal views. The town itself has a rich history, with the WWII bunkers offering a fascinating glimpse into the area’s past. Essential Information for Your Stay

Powered & Unpowered Sites: Please contact the park directly for details on availability and site numbers.

Rating: ★★★★☆ (4/5 Stars based on reviews)

Mobile Phone Coverage: Telstra 4G is available and reliable in the area.

Generator Use: Please check with park management as rules may apply.

Suitable For: Tents, caravans, campervans, motorhomes, and large rigs.

Open Fires: Open fires are not permitted. Please use designated BBQ facilities.

Pet Friendly: Pets are not allowed at this property.

Fishing: Excellent fishing is available in the nearby Mallacoota Inlet for species like bream and flathead.

Short Walks: Plenty of walking tracks available, including the Betka Creek to Secret Beach Walk.

Number of Sites: Contact the park for the exact number of sites as it can vary based on bookings and season.

Site Surface: Grassed sites.

Explore Mallacoota and Beyond

Local Attractions

  • Mallacoota Inlet: A vast, beautiful waterway perfect for boating, fishing and kayaking.
  • Croajingolong National Park: A UNESCO World Biosphere Reserve with stunning coastal walks and diverse wildlife.
  • Gabo Island Lighthouse: A historic lighthouse accessible by a short boat trip.
  • Mallacoota WWII Bunker: A fascinating glimpse into the area’s wartime history.

Seasonal Weather Forecast

  • Summer (Dec-Feb): Average maximums around $24^\circ$C. Warm and sunny, perfect for beach and water activities.
  • Autumn (Mar-May): Temperatures cool slightly with average maximums around $20^\circ$C. A great time for bushwalking and exploring.
  • Winter (Jun-Aug): Average maximums around $15^\circ$C. Cooler days and nights, with morning frosts possible. Best for quiet escapes and spotting migratory birds.
  • Spring (Sep-Nov): Temperatures begin to rise with average maximums around $18^\circ$C. The landscape comes alive with wildflowers, and fishing is great.
